The Suzuki Equator, a mid-size pickup truck, was produced in the United States from 2009 to 2012 and in Canada from 2009 to 2010. Based on the rugged Nissan Frontier platform, it offered a reliable option for buyers seeking a functional work or recreational pickup.
Although the Equator only existed in one generation, its safety systems continued to evolve during its production run. The airbag control units, in particular, had to accommodate these advances to ensure optimal functioning of the passive safety systems.

The sole generation of the Suzuki Equator was offered as an Extended Cab (single cab) and a Crew Cab (double cab). Despite the lack of major facelifts, improvements were continually incorporated into the vehicle, which could also affect the electronic components.
One example of this is the introduction of stability control: From 2010, it was standard on V6 models, and from 2012, it became standard for all Equator variants. These enhancements to active safety systems often require adjustments to the interaction with the central airbag control unit.
The engines, such as the 2.5-liter four-cylinder or the more powerful 4.0-liter V6, also had no direct influence on the basic function of the airbag control unit, but the equipment variant can be relevant for the correct module selection.
Suzuki Equator airbag control units can be uniquely identified by their specific part number, vehicle year, and vehicle identification number (VIN). Each version of the control unit has been developed for optimal compatibility with the respective model year and the installed safety systems.
The part number can be found directly on the housing of the airbag control unit, which is usually located under the carpet in the center tunnel or on the center console. It's crucial to check this number precisely, as even small deviations can lead to incompatibilities.
In addition to the part number, the year of manufacture of your Suzuki Equator provides important information about the possible software version and hardware of the control unit. The vehicle identification number (VIN) on your registration certificate allows for precise tracing of your pickup's original equipment.
Since the Equator was available in body styles such as Extended Cab and Crew Cab, it's advisable to consider this information during identification. A correctly identified airbag control unit is the foundation for a successful and safe repair.
The Suzuki Equator's airbag equipment varied depending on the model year and the chosen trim level, with a focus on basic and robust safety systems. While all models came standard with driver and passenger airbags, advanced safety features were introduced over the course of production.
From the beginning of production, driver and passenger airbags were standard equipment in all Suzuki Equator models, including the Extended Cab and Crew Cab variants. This provided a solid foundation for occupant protection in the event of a collision.
As already mentioned, active safety was further improved starting in 2010 with the standard stability control on the V6 models. Starting in the 2012 model year, this was then standardized on all Suzuki Equator models, significantly increasing driving safety and optimizing the interaction with the airbag system.
Additional features such as heated seats or leather seats, which were primarily available as options on the Crew Cab, had no direct impact on the number or type of airbags. Nevertheless, the airbag control unit was always the central unit responsible for the correct deployment of the available airbags and seatbelt pretensioners to provide optimal occupant protection.
